"Balance" as a category for books encompasses works that explore the concept of equilibrium in various aspects of life, nature, and society. These books delve into themes such as work-life balance, mental and emotional well-being, ecological sustainability, and the harmonious coexistence of diverse cultures and ideas. They may include self-help guides, philosophical treatises, environmental studies, and narratives that illustrate the pursuit of balance through personal stories or fictional accounts. The overarching goal of this genre is to provide readers with insights and strategies to achieve a more balanced and fulfilling life, fostering a deeper understanding of how equilibrium can be maintained in an ever-changing world.

1. A Wizard Of Earthsea by Ursula K. Le Guin
A gifted but reckless island boy is apprenticed as a wizard, and after a prideful spell unleashes a shadow that follows him across the archipelago, he must undertake a perilous journey to pursue and confront it; through trials, solitude, and the learning of true names and balance, he grows from brash youth into a wiser, accountable sorcerer.

2. I Ching by China
The Book of Changes
This ancient Chinese text is a divination system and book of wisdom. It provides guidance for moral and ethical decisions through 64 hexagrams, which are six-line figures made up of broken and unbroken lines. Each hexagram represents a specific situation or state of affairs, and the text provides interpretations and advice for each. The book has been used for centuries as a tool for decision-making, prediction, and gaining deeper understanding of situations and relationships.

3. The Farthest Shore by Ursula K. Le Guin
In this third installment of a high-fantasy series, a young prince and an archmage set out on a harrowing journey to discover the cause of a mysterious blight that is draining magic and life from their world. As they travel to the farthest reaches of their archipelago, facing dragons and confronting death itself, they must unravel a complex web of greed and power. The narrative explores profound themes such as the balance between life and death, the true cost of immortality, and the necessity of accepting one's own mortality, culminating in a quest that is as much about inner discovery as it is about saving their realm from the encroaching darkness.

4. Gift From The Sea by Anne Morrow Lindbergh
In this lyrical and introspective work, the author reflects on the complexities of a woman's life and the challenges of balancing societal expectations, relationships, and personal growth. Drawing inspiration from her time on a seaside retreat, she uses the metaphor of various shells found on the beach to explore themes of solitude, love, and the evolving stages of a woman's life. Through her meditations, she advocates for simplicity and inner peace, suggesting that women can find strength and renewal by periodically withdrawing from the demands of everyday life, much like the ebb and flow of the ocean's tides.

5. Eat, Pray, Love by Elizabeth Gilbert
One Woman's Search for Everything Across Italy, India and Indonesia
The memoir chronicles a woman's journey of self-discovery and healing after a painful divorce. She spends a year traveling to three different countries, each representing a different aspect of her personal growth. In Italy, she indulges in pleasure and learns to appreciate life's simple joys. In India, she explores her spirituality and finds inner peace through meditation. In Indonesia, she seeks to balance the two extremes and ends up finding love again. Her experiences throughout the year help her regain her sense of self and happiness.

6. Thief Of Time by Terry Pratchett
A Novel of Discworld
In this satirical fantasy novel, the concept of time is personified and at risk as a young clockmaker is tricked into creating a time-stopping clock, which could bring about the end of the world. Meanwhile, the history monks, guardians of time, along with the anthropomorphic personification of Death and his granddaughter, work to prevent this temporal catastrophe. The narrative weaves through multiple storylines filled with quirky characters, including a martial arts monk with a talent for baking, as they confront the nature of time, the importance of living in the moment, and the challenge of managing an increasingly unstable reality. The book combines humor, philosophy, and a richly detailed world to explore the complexities of time and human existence.

8. The Other Wind by Ursula K. Le Guin
In this fantasy novel, the last in its series, the narrative follows a former goatherd who has become a powerful mage, as he grapples with troubling dreams of the dead calling to the living. The story explores themes of mortality, the afterlife, and the need for cultural and spiritual reconciliation. As the mage and a cast of diverse characters, including a dragon, a young woman with half-dragon heritage, and a disenchanted princess, embark on a quest to heal the breach between the worlds of the living and the dead, they confront ancient wrongs and seek to restore the balance of magic in their world. The novel delves into the consequences of past actions and the importance of understanding and respecting the natural order.

9. Wintersmith by Terry Pratchett
In this enchanting tale, a young witch-in-training named Tiffany Aching inadvertently attracts the attention of the Wintersmith, the elemental spirit of winter, during a dance meant only for the gods. As the Wintersmith becomes infatuated with Tiffany, the balance of the seasons is thrown into chaos, threatening the very fabric of the world. With the help of her fellow witches and the mischievous Nac Mac Feegle, Tiffany must navigate the complexities of magic, identity, and responsibility to restore order and find her place in the world.
